> On 06/28/2016 02:59 AM, Dexuan Cui wrote:
> > The idea here is: IMO the syscalls sys_read()/write() shoudn't return
> > -ENOMEM, so I have to make sure the buffer allocation succeeds?
> >
> > I tried to use kmalloc with __GFP_NOFAIL, but I hit a warning in
> > in mm/page_alloc.c:
> > WARN_ON_ONCE((gfp_flags & __GFP_NOFAIL) && (order > 1));
> >
> > What error code do you think I should return?
> > EAGAIN, ERESTARTSYS, or something else?
> >
> > May I have your suggestion? Thanks!
>
> What happens as far as errno is concerned when an application makes a
> read() call against a (say TCP) socket associated with a connection
> which has been reset?
I suppose it is ECONNRESET (Connection reset by peer).

> Is it limited to those errno values listed in the
> read() manpage, or does it end-up getting an errno value from those
> listed in the recv() manpage? Or, perhaps even one not (presently)
> listed in either?
>
> rick jones

Actually "man read/write" says "Other errors may occur, depending on the
object connected to fd".

"man send/recv" indeed lists ENOMEM.

Considering AF_HYPERV is a new socket type, ENOMEM seems OK to me
and I'm going to post a new version of the patch.

In the long run, I think we should add a new API in the VMBus driver,
allowing data copy from VMBus ringbuffer into user mode buffer directly.
This way, we can even eliminate this temporary buffer.
